## v3.2.0 — Changed defaults (MetricMule sidecar)

Heads up for release: MetricMule now flushes aggregates every 15s instead of 60s, and histogram buckets are log-spaced by default. Memory ceiling dropped too, so noisy pods get throttled rather than OOM-killed. Nothing breaking, but dashboards will look spikier for a day. The new shipped defaults are listed below.

config for kawif-hahig:
zorix:
  log_level: error
  metrics_host: metrics.zorix.lumiclabs.internal
  pool_size: 16

Ticket: FIELD-2281 — Expired credentials blocking offline sync

For the weekly sync: the Heronpath field-survey app's offline mode stopped reconciling on Monday because the cached sync token expired while crews were out of coverage. Surveys queued locally are intact, but uploads fail silently until re-auth. We've extended token lifetime to 30 days and reissued credentials. The replacement key for the internal sync service follows.

service key, fafog-fahaf: vxb3-x55

Subject: Quickstore 4.2 — bloom filter now fronts the KV layer

Plugin authors: starting with this release, Quickstore places a bloom filter ahead of the key-value store. Negative lookups return faster; false positives fall through safely. No API changes are required on your side. Verify your plugin against the staging build referenced below.

session token of fahif-tadup = htk3_9c7

Ticket: Missed pick-up — notarised deed for the Calloway Mill transfer. The scheduled courier from Brantlee Logistics did not arrive during the 09:00–11:00 window on Tuesday, and the deed remains sealed in the secure drawer at the Ostermoor warehouse office. Legal has confirmed the document must reach the Ferndale office before Friday. A replacement rider from Larkspur Dispatch is booked for tomorrow morning. At the point of hand-over, relay this instruction verbatim:

dispatch memo: the lamwyn fenwyn courier leaves the wenir ledger at gate 7175 under passcode 822969